Perfect Game USA, the premier provider of amateur baseball events, is seeking dedicated individuals for the position of Field Manager Intern. In this role, you will be responsible for scoring and completing games using our state-of-the-art DiamondKast software. Your tasks will include meticulously recording every play, managing substitutions, noting player performance, managing externally sourced staff (umpires and grounds crew), and collecting video of top performers.
As a Field Manager Intern,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of events at the assigned field. You will be the main representative from Perfect Game, responsible for confirming field readiness, ensuring the presence of umpires, and verifying the preparedness of both participating teams. Punctuality is key, and you will be entrusted to ensure all games commence on time.
Responsibilities:
- Score and complete each game using DiamondKast software.
- Record every play, substitution change, and pitch using the DiamondKast application on the provided iPad.
- Taking scouting notes and recording content of top performing athletes
- Ensure smooth operation at the assigned field.
- Confirm the field is prepared for play, coordinating with the grounds crew if necessary.
- Verify the presence of umpires on the property before games.
- Confirm the readiness of both teams to start play at the designated time.
- Ensure all games start on time.
- Present yourself in a professional manner with customers, players, staff, and scouts at all times.
Minimum Qualifications:
- Preferred solid understanding of baseball fundamentals and gameplay.
- Playing or coaching background is a plus.
- Experience in scouting and/or scorekeeping is a plus.
- Experience playing Baseball/Softball is a plus.
Interview Process:
- The first step in the interview process involves a behavioral screening session, where candidates will be asked to record themselves providing responses to specific questions selected by the hiring team.
Perfect Game Offers:
- Per-game compensation (three to six games per day).
- $25 per completed game (please note that game assignments are subject to change due to weather and other unforeseen circumstances).
- Internship credit is available for eligible students.
